在数字化时代,网站已成为个人和企业展示自身形象、传递信息的重要平台。对于许多初学者而言,网站搭建可能是一项看似复杂且难以入门的任务。然而,通过分步骤学习和实践,任何人都可以掌握这一技能。本文将详细介绍网站搭建的基本流程,并特别参考了知乎上的相关文章,为大家提供一个清晰、实用的指南。

一、明确网站目标与定位

在开始搭建网站之前,首先需要明确网站的目标和定位。这包括确定网站的主要内容、目标受众、以及希望通过网站实现的功能。清晰的目标和定位有助于后续的设计和开发工作更加有针对性。

二、选择域名与服务器

1. 域名选择

域名是网站的“门牌号”,选择一个简洁、易记且与网站内容相关的域名至关重要。在选择域名时,还需要考虑域名的后缀(如.com、.cn等),以确保其专业性和可信度。

2. 服务器选择

服务器是存放网站文件和运行程序的平台。根据网站的预期访问量、功能需求以及预算,可以选择不同的服务器类型和配置。对于初学者来说,虚拟主机是一个经济且实用的选择。

三、规划网站结构与设计布局

1. 网站结构规划

合理的网站结构有助于提升用户体验和搜索引擎优化(SEO)。在规划网站结构时,需要考虑页面之间的逻辑关系、导航栏的设置以及内容的层次结构。

2. 设计布局

网站的视觉设计对于吸引用户至关重要。在设计布局时,需要注重色彩搭配、字体选择、图片使用等方面,以打造出既美观又实用的网站界面。可以参考优秀的网站设计案例或使用专业的设计工具进行辅助设计。

四、编写网站内容与代码

1. 内容创作

高质量的内容是网站吸引用户的关键。在编写内容时,需要确保信息的准确性和时效性,同时注重语言的通顺和可读性。此外,还可以通过添加图片、视频等多媒体元素来丰富网站的视觉效果。

2. 代码编写

网站的实现离不开代码的编写。根据网站的结构和功能需求,选择合适的编程语言和框架进行开发。对于初学者来说,可以从简单的HTML和CSS入手,逐步学习JavaScript等前端技术和PHP、Python等后端技术。

五、测试与优化

1. 功能测试

在网站搭建完成后,需要进行全面的测试以确保各项功能的正常运行。这包括链接测试、表单测试、兼容性测试等。通过测试可以及时发现并修复潜在的问题。

2. 性能优化

为了提升网站的加载速度和用户体验,还需要对网站进行性能优化。这包括压缩图片大小、优化代码结构、使用缓存技术等。通过性能优化可以显著提升网站的响应速度和稳定性。

六、发布与维护

1. 网站发布

在完成所有测试和优化后,可以将网站部署到服务器上并进行公开发布。此时需要注意备份网站数据以防万一。

2. 持续维护

网站发布后并不意味着任务的结束。为了保持网站的活力和吸引力,需要定期更新内容、修复漏洞以及优化性能。通过持续的维护和管理可以让网站长期稳定运行并不断壮大。